How they compare
Congo currently reports 34,336 against 28,566 in Burkina Faso, a difference of 5,770.
That makes Congo's figure about 1.2 times Burkina Faso's.
Across all 24 years both countries report, Congo has been ahead every year.
Burkina Faso ranks 98th and Congo ranks 95th of 201 countries.
Congo has averaged higher in every one of the 5 decades both report.
Head to head by decade
| Decade | Burkina Faso | Congo | Difference | Ahead |
|---|---|---|---|---|
| 1970s | 2,645 | 6,503 | 3,858 | Congo |
| 1980s | 4,887 | 21,706 | 16,818 | Congo |
| 1990s | 7,454 | 13,748 | 6,294 | Congo |
| 2000s | 19,398 | 41,648 | 22,250 | Congo |
| 2010s | 27,381 | 34,336 | 6,955 | Congo |
Averages of every year both report within each decade.

About this data
Secondary vocational pupils are the number of secondary students enrolled in technical and vocational education programs, including teacher training.
